The reason a bullet from an AS50 or any other firearm may miss a target can be due to several factors:

  1. Aim and skill of the shooter: The accuracy of a shot depends on the shooter's skill and experience. Even with a high-powered rifle like the AS50, if the shooter is not proficient or if they misjudge the trajectory or distance, the shot can miss the target.
  2. Environmental factors: External conditions such as wind, rain, and visibility can affect the path of a bullet. Wind, in particular, can have a significant impact on a bullet's trajectory, causing it to miss the intended target.
  3. Ballistic characteristics: The type of ammunition used and the specific characteristics of the AS50 can influence the bullet's flight path. Different bullets have different ballistics, and this can lead to variations in accuracy.
  4. Obstacles: Physical obstacles between the shooter and the target, such as cover or terrain, can cause a bullet to miss. Even minor obstructions can alter the bullet's trajectory.
  5. Distance: The farther the target, the more challenging it is to achieve accuracy. Long-range shots require careful calculations and adjustments.
  6. Mechanical issues: In some cases, there can be mechanical issues with the firearm, scope, or ammunition that affect accuracy.
